Try and keep your knees less contracted during your corks. On a cork set up, keep your leg relaxed, or extended throughout, contracting and then extending at the peek looks funny. When you land avoid landing with contracted legs and then extending them for another flip. Also, you leave from your toes a lot. Try and keep your feet flat-foot on the ground at all times. Watch out for ghosting.

I like how well you kept it going. Pretty smooth, and you didn't change your direction which let you spin for a while. Evenly paced throughout, although it got repetitive, there was no lack of tricks that were done.
